Event Description


COURSE TIMES ARE LOCAL MOUNTAIN TIME, NOT EST!
 
This one day course will help prepare you for spending time in the mountains during the winter as well as climbing higher glaciated peaks.  Our guides will get you out on various snow terrain to teach you proper technique and movement.
 
Benefits
·         Learn how to travel as a roped team
·         Learn different ways of walking in crampons and when to use each technique
·         Learn proper use of your mountaineering axe
·         Learn how to self-arrest a fall
 
Prerequisites
·         Ability to spend a full day out in the mountains
·         Generally fit

Biography


Colorado Mountain School
The Colorado Mountain School, under various 
names, has been guiding continuously in Colorado since 1877, and has been Rocky Mountain National Park’s exclusive technical climbing concessionaire since the Park’s creation in 1915.  Today, CMS is the largest guide service in Colorado and has more AMGA certified guides than any other guide service in the state. We remain the exclusive climbing concessionaire for Rocky Mountain National Park and have developed the most complete outdoor climbing curriculum in the United States.
